Soy-Butter Noodles with Shrimp
Prep: 15 minutes
Cook: 20 minutes • Serves: 4
1 pound raw 16-20 count peeled and deveined tail-on shrimp, thawed if necessary, tail shells removed and patted dry
4 garlic cloves, minced
1/2 (16-ounce) package PICS orecchiette
3 cups vegetable stock
2 tablespoons grated Parmesan cheese plus additional for garnish (optional)
2 tablespoons PICS lite soy sauce
Green onions for garnish (optional)
1. In large high-sided skillet, melt 1 tablespoon butter over medium-high heat. Add shrimp; cook 4 minutes or until shrimp turn opaque throughout, turning once. Transfer shrimp to paper towel-lined plate.
2.In same skillet with drippings, melt 1 tablespoon butter over medium-high heat. Add garlic; cook 1 minute or until fragrant, stirring frequently. Add orecchiette and stock; heat to a boil. Reduce heat to low; cover and cook 10 minutes or until liquid has reduced by half and orecchiette is al dente, stirring occasionally. Stir in cheese, soy sauce and remaining 2 tablespoons butter; increase heat to medium and cook 2 minutes or until butter is melted and sauce is slightly thickened, stirring frequently. Fold in shrimp. Makes about 5 cups noodles.
3.Serve noodles garnished with cheese and onions, if desired.
Approximate nutritional values per serving (1-1/4 cups):
413 Calories, 14g Fat (8g Saturated), 154mg Cholesterol, 1303mg Sodium,
49g Carbohydrates, 2g Fiber, 4g Sugars, 2g Added Sugars, 22g Protein
Chef Tip:
Serve this dish drizzled with chili crisp for a bit of spice.
